Dear Lone Star Boxer, Sharon, Jennifer Crane (who did our home visit and helped us on our dog interview), and the many other volunteers who work behind the scenes to make an adoption happen; Thank you. We adopted Kali (formerly Copper) about four weeks ago. She is adjusting very well, and is really quick to learn the rules, although our dachshund is also training Kali to be her partner in crime. They have discovered the wonders of working together to get to the cat food, open doors, corner the cat, etc. But they also spend a good part of each day snuggled up on their new sheepskin bed. Kali has the perfect "who me?" look. I don't know if every boxer has that face, but it's irresistible. She can walk in with her nose covered in kitty litter, and all I can do is laugh. At least it's all-natural litter! She is still getting used to the cat, although he has laid claim to her, and accepted her as part of his dominion. She just gets really excited when he jumps up out of no where (which he tends to do on purpose to see her go all a-quiver), but she knows she is not supposed to chase him. She is very good with our son; their morning routine is for him to get a cup of milk and watch cartoons while lying on her side. She takes it all in stride and only asks for a cheerio or two in return (although a nice piece of cheese dropped from the highchair isn't bad either). I often find him walking around with a rawhide in his hand and Kali following slowly as if to say: "Umm, excuse me, may I have that back?" Never pushy or aggressive, just very patient and little confused. Kali gets to spend Saturday and Sundays with us at our friend's house. They have three dogs, and a mastiff also comes over to play. The whole pack of them plays and run and chase. She loves meeting the play-friends, and their people, and is always quick to defend Marie (our doxie), when she picks a fight she can't finish. I've included some pictures of their most recent play time. Hopefully we will have more happy pictures to send! Thank you so much for all the time, care and love you put into one great dog. She'll never forget it and neither will we! Robyn, James, and Beau Locklin. |
